Today, Patty Ostendorff, Rudi Kammereck and I headed up to Daroga State Park
in Douglas County.
The Black-and -white Warbler was easily found near the play area earlier
described. It was with a small flock of Golden-crowned Kinglets. We were
treated to great views of the B&W as it worked the bark of pines and
poplars.
Also at the park were Canvasbacks and Redheads including a partial albino
female Redhead. A singing Townsend's Solitaire was at the south end of the
park. We enjoyed watching a river otter swimming in the lake.
